Why Botswana Needs Flexible Energy Storage Now
Did you know Botswana's peak electricity demand grew by 17% between 2020-2023? With increasing mining operations and urban expansion, traditional grid systems struggle to keep pace. Containerized energy storage systems (CESS) offer a mobile, scalable solution that's transforming Botswana's energy landscape.
Key Industry Applications
- Mining Operations: 24/7 power for remote sites
- Solar Farms: Storing daytime solar energy for night use
- Healthcare Facilities: Backup power for critical equipment
- Agricultural Processing: Stabilizing power for refrigeration units

Real-World Success Stories
Let's examine two Botswana implementations:
Case Study 1: Solar-Hybrid Mine Power
- Location: Kalahari Copperbelt
- System: 2MW solar + 1.2MWh storage
- Result: 40% reduction in diesel consumption
Case Study 2: Hospital Backup System
- Location: Gaborone
- Capacity: 250kWh lithium-ion storage
- Outcome: Zero power interruptions during 2022 grid failures

FAQ: Containerized Energy Storage in Botswana
How long do these systems typically last?
Most installations operate efficiently for 10-15 years with proper maintenance.
Can they integrate with existing diesel generators?
Absolutely! Hybrid systems combining solar, storage and generators are our specialty.
What's the lead time for delivery?
Standard units ship in 6-8 weeks, with rapid deployment possible in 72 hours for emergencies.
